Задать вопрос
eashla
@eashla

Почему не срабатывает скрипт через планировщик cron?

9af0aec183bc4ad986b9faf1503d3911.jpg
e2c72d90c7324e38a75acdd180990c3d.jpg
ecb3c137042b42d082335d80d1f2aa64.jpg

В общем вручную скрипт работает и создаёт нормальный архив с нормальным размером, а если работает cron, то по каким то причинам получаю файл 45 кб. Может чего упустил - подскажите как быть.
  • Вопрос задан
  • 679 просмотров
Подписаться 1 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Учебный центр «Микротест»
    Сетевое администрирование ОС Astra Linux Special Edition 1.8
    2 недели
    Далее
  • Учебный центр «Микротест»
    Linux уровень 4. Диагностика и устранение неполадок в Linux (Линукс)
    1 неделя
    Далее
  • Учебный центр «Микротест»
    Linux уровень 4. Диагностика и устранение неполадок в Linux (Линукс)
    1 день
    Далее
Решения вопроса 1
saboteur_kiev
@saboteur_kiev Куратор тега Linux
software engineer
а что скрипт выводит на stdout при запуске из крона?
Самая распространненая ошибка в том, что при логине юзера выполняются всякие .bashrc и .profile, а при запуске из крона - нет, поэтому банально в PATH может не быть нужных путей к например mount.cifs
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
@SergeyShibka
добавь рута в строке запуска задачи в кроне:

0 22 * * * root /etc/skript

да и лог крона в случае не отрабатывания нужно поглядеть, там сразу будет видно.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ы